Lisle was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their eighth straight loss. They were a single run away from ending the streak, but they lost a 4-3 heartbreaker at the hands of the Reed-Custer Comets. The result was an unpleasant reminder to the Lions of the 15-0 defeat they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in May of 2024.
Emily Bieniasz was cooking despite her team's loss, going a perfect 2-for-2 with two RBI. McKenna Riley was another key player, going 2-for-4 with two doubles and one run.
Lisle's loss dropped their record down to 4-15. As for Reed-Custer, their win ended a four-game drought at home and bumped them up to 10-15.
While Lisle had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
